Diamond & Titan; Fate of 2 Pitties

2 beloved rescue pets, DIAMOND & TITAN, are impounded at the county shelter after an accidental escape from their home, which resulted in a bite incident. These 2 family dogs have NO prior bite history! Under the local ordinance, a dog bite incident without a prior history is NOT subject to immediate euthanasia. Animal Services has not recognized the protections of the ordinance in this case.

The owners, a husband & wife who have been amazing in raising money for Pitbull advocacy over the last year, were separated during the time of questioning. The dogs' owners were threatened and told if they did not surrender the dogs they would be arrested. Animal services is not a law enforcement agency and has NO authority to arrest anyone. Further, if animal services had called law enforcement, the police cannot arrest someone and criminally charge them for refusing to surrender family pets. These Lee County citizens were threatened, coerced, and lied to - that is how Lee County Animal Services was able to get one of them to sign an "alleged" surrender document.

Within minutes of that moment, they rushed to animal services to clarify what they had signed, & receive copies of the papers they signed. Animal services adamantly refused to give them a copy of the document that had been signed. The County refused to honor their pleas to reverse the coerced surrender, and has continued to refuse to let the owners rescind the coerced decision. Two lawyers immediately joined the fight to free these dogs.

This poor family & their children been denied due process & visitation of DIAMOND & TITAN from the system, which did not follow protocol & seems to have a mission to make examples of all local Pitbull bite cases. Make no mistake, if these dogs were Labs or cocker spaniels, they would not have been sent to death row at Lee County Animal Services.

During the months these two wrongly seized dogs were in the shelter, all requests for information about them have been denied. The couple have NEVER been allowed to see the dogs. They have been told at all times that the dogs are Fine. Well, they are not fine. In December, sweet DIAMOND became terminally ill under Animal Services care, & unfortunately was euthanized due to the extent & lack of treatment of her illness ... Animal Services told the owners as late as December 28th, that the dogs were "fine" & being cared for. The family was not notified until DIAMOND had 48 hours to live, according to Animal Services veterinarian.

What is TITAN's fate? He was only 7 months out of a horrific abuse & neglect situation at the time he was impounded, & was still recovering emotionally & physically from his severe injuries.  Titan suffers from a chronic kidney illness & requires medication ... We have no way of knowing if he is receiving it.

TITAN must be shutting down in that shelter, having no contact with his family & likely suffering from depression (extremely common in these situations).
